Overview


Summary

Cecil County, Maryland is seeking sealed proposals for a Contractor(s) to provide Transit & Heavy Machinery Fleet Maintenance service of the County’s fleet of transit vehicles and heavy equipment and related responsibilities as specified within the Scope of Work and attached specifications from qualified firms, individuals, etc., having specific experience identified in the Request for Proposal (RFP).

This Request for Proposal (RFP) is intended to secure the services of an experienced Contractor to provide transit and/or heavy machinery maintenance and equipment maintenance services for the County for approximately 135 (one hundred thirty-five) pieces of equipment.



Background

Cecil County, Maryland currently operates a transit fleet of approximately twenty-one (21) various size buses and nine (9) passenger van vehicles and pieces of equipment (see Attachment “Vehicle Equipment Listing” for list of vehicles and equipment).

Heavy Machinery equipment is approximately fifty-six (56) vehicles, ranging from but not limited to Skid-Steers, Backhoes, Loaders, and Excavators. Make/model of machinery varies.

The County has various mowers, trailers, snowplows, salt spreaders, and commercial trailers.

Heavy equipment or transit vehicle parts/accessories and other auxiliary installation may be required.

This approach to equipment maintenance is in effect for all County vehicles and equipment under this contract.
